本文翻译自:Remove or uninstall library previously added : cocoapods

I added an external framework via cocoapods into my iOS application. 我通过cocoapods将一个外部框架添加到我的iOS应用程序中。 How can i remove that library from the project? 如何从项目中删除该库?


#1楼

参考:https://stackoom.com/question/vhIh/删除或卸载以前添加的库-cocoapods


#2楼

从Podfile中删除lib,然后再次pod install


#3楼

Since the accepted answer's side effects have been removed by a script written by Kyle Fuller - deintegrate , I'll post the proper workflow here: 由于接受的答案的副作用已被Kyle Fuller编写的脚本删除 - 解体 ,我将在此处发布正确的工作流程:

  1. Install clean: 安装干净:

     $ sudo gem install cocoapods-clean 
  2. Run deintegrate in the folder of the project: 在项目的文件夹中运行deintegrate:

    $ pod deintegrate

  3. Clean: 清洁:

    $ pod clean

  4. Modify your podfile (delete the lines with the pods you don't want to use anymore) and run: 修改您的podfile(删除包含您不想再使用的pod的行)并运行:

    $ pod install

Done. 完成。


#4楼

  1. Remove pod name(which to remove) from Podfile and then 从Podfile中删除pod名称(要删除),然后
  2. Open Terminal, set project folder path 打开终端,设置项目文件夹路径
  3. Run pod install --no-integrate 运行pod install --no-integrate

#5楼

  1. Remove the library from your Podfile 从Podfile中删除库

  2. Run pod install on the terminal 在终端上运行pod install


#6楼

Remove pod name from Podfile then Open Terminal, set project folder path and Run pod update command. Podfile删除pod名称,然后打开Terminal,设置项目文件夹路径和Run pod update命令。

NOTE: pod update will update all the libraries to the latest version and will also remove those libraries whose name have been removed from podfile. 注意: pod update会将所有库更新为最新版本,并且还将删除已从podfile中删除其名称的库。

删除或卸载以前添加的库:cocoapods相关推荐

  1. 如何安装CocoaPods,以便在Xcode中快速添加第三方库

    文章目录 1. 安装CocoaPods 2. 用CocoaPods来添加第三方库 CocoaPods 是一个负责管理 Xcode项目中第三方开源库的工具.CocoaPods项目源码 通过 CocoaP ...

  2. 03_NSIS_将卸载信息添加到“添加、删除程序”

    03_NSIS_将卸载信息添加到"添加.删除程序" 1. 使用方式 2. 在注册表添加必要信息 2.1 添加应用程序名称 2.2 添加卸载程序的路径和文件名 2.3 删除添加的注册 ...

  3. android stuido 在线安装svn插件,添加版本库无响应

    问题:android stuido 中在线安装svn插件,添加版本库无响应. 原因: 由于android stuido 版本较高,在线安装1.6x 版本的svn,添加版本库一直没有响应,最后卡死.. ...

  4. php发布编辑删除功能,php实现添加修改删除

    在学习 jquery easyui 前应该先到官网下载最新版本 /download/index.php 先看一下运行后的页面 1.列表展示 2.新增页面 3.修改页面 ...... 如 : 你得访问地 ...

  5. OpenWRT 添加第三方库

    简介 在OpenWRT 中,它已经包含许多开源库,在make menuconfig -> Libraries 中可以看到,有很多库都已经添加了. 当要用的库在OpenWRT里找不到时,就需要自己 ...

  6. 解决AutoDesk Eagle双击无法启动及语言修改添加元件库的问题

    这篇博文做个记录,每次在安装Autodesk eagle后都必须做些工作才能使eagle正常工作.怕忘记,所以记录在这里,但愿也能给需要的童鞋做个参考. 1.双击以后无法启动 双击图标后,一闪就退出了 ...

  7. CMake教程(二)- 添加静态库文件和动态库文件

    CMake教程(二)- 添加静态库文件和动态库文件 什么是库文件 静态链接库 动态链接库 静态库和动态库的区别 如何在CMake中添加库文件 CMake 中 target_link_libraries ...

  8. Linux LVM逻辑卷配置过程详解(创建,增加,减少,删除,卸载)

    Linux LVM逻辑卷配置过程详解(创建,增加,减少,删除,卸载) Linux LVM逻辑卷配置过程详解 许多Linux使用者安装操作系统时都会遇到这样的困境:如何精确评估和分配各个硬盘分区的容量, ...

  9. VS2010中添加第三方库目录VC++ Directories

    VS2010取消了08之前在options里面添加第三方库目录的设置,新的设置方法如下: View->Property Manager, 在Property Manager框里面有Debug|W ...

最新文章

  1. 剑指 Offer 07. 重建二叉树【千字分析,三种方法】
  2. activemq 延时队列以及不生效问题
  3. 同理心是通往成功架构的桥梁
  4. HDU.6761.Minimum Index(Lyndon分解)
  5. deepin20系统选择手动安装盘_深度系统Deepin 20最新正式版发布:全面升级
  6. Panoptic Segmentation论文笔记
  7. mysql基本命令大全_Django 学习笔记之 如何设置和操作 mysql 数据库
  8. hiveserver2启动不起来_汽车一键启动除了点火,还有这些功能!车主:现在才明白...
  9. Security+ 学习笔记38 TCP/IP网络
  10. aspose word 删除空行_Word:删除空行
  11. Python POST登陆linkedin分析(完),完整实现过程
  12. Linux学习-软件磁盘阵列
  13. 协调端到端的供应链管理——SCM
  14. ubuntu如何安装libz库
  15. 妙控鼠标灵敏度太低怎么办
  16. java面试的一些流程问题
  17. [Java经典题目] 随机得到一个[ 1-100]之间的年龄
  18. depot_tools更新失败
  19. RDMA RC UC UD
  20. c#dataview遍历_C# DataView.Find方法代码示例

热门文章

  1. 努比亚压力键不显示菜单问题
  2. 算法--------数组--------容纳最多的水
  3. Android 判断屏幕方向一个大坑
  4. Android 做项目总结
  5. 线程间到底共享了哪些进程资源
  6. 【java新】Optional pk 空指针
  7. uniapp自定义顶部导航组件
  8. vue $emit $on 非父子非兄弟组件传值
  9. Spring boot 整合 Mybatis 实现增删改查(MyEclipse版)
  10. id设置为10000开始